Idea Exchange: A Piglet in a pot: Solution for megaesophagus
A reader tip for holding patients upright after eating.
Advertisement
Because of Piglet's congenital megaesophagus, her owner was holding her upright for 20 minutes after feeding every four hours. My solution to keep Piglet upright was to cut a hole in the top of a lid of a tin container and fit it with a tubular stockinette Piglet could poke her head and shoulders through to remain upright. Piglet has since grown into a laundry detergent container.
